(1)The governing body of any maintained school shall be responsible for determining whether or not to provide—
(a)part-time education suitable to the requirements of persons of any age over compulsory school age; or
(b)full-time education suitable to the requirements of persons who have attained the age of 19;
but the governing body of a community or foundation special school shall not determine to provide, or to cease to provide, such education without the consent of the local education authority.
(2)It shall be the duty of the governing body of any such school which provides such education to secure that, except in such circumstances as may be prescribed, such education is not provided at any time in a room where pupils are at that time being taught.
(3)This section shall not apply to part-time education provided under a partnership arrangement to which section 60A of the [1992 c. 13.] Further and Higher Education Act 1992 (as inserted by section 125(4) of this Act) applies.
